Before you start looking for home mortgages, consider your credit score and make sure you do what you can to make sure it’s good. Credit requirements grow stricter every year, so make sure that your credit is free of any errors that could prove to be costly.
You will need to show a work history that goes back a while before you are considered for a mortgage. A majority of lenders will require two years of solid work history in order to approve any loan. If you switch your job frequently, you may end up denied. Make sure you don’t quit your job while you’re applying for your mortgage loan, too.

If you are having problems with your mortgage, look for some help as soon as possible. Counseling is a good way to start if you are having difficultly affording the minimum amount. HUD will provide counseling to consumers in every part of the nation. A HUD-approved counselor will help you prevent your house from foreclosure.Call HUD or visit them online.

Reduce your debts before applying for a mortgage. A home mortgage is a huge responsibility and you want to be sure that you will be able to make the payments, and you should be able to comfortably afford it. Having minimal debt will make it easier to do just that.
When you go to see the mortgage lender, bring along all your financial records. Lenders want to see bank statements, income documentation and proof of any other existing assets. Have all the paperwork well-organized. If you are well-prepared you are more likely to be approved and the process will go quicker.

Consider making extra payments every now and then. This added payment will be applied to the principal amount. Making an extra payment often gets your mortgage paid off faster and saves you money on interest.
